Heads up: when the Hollyvane replica falls more than 30 seconds behind primary, the `replica-lag-high` alarm fires and read traffic auto-shifts to primary. This is usually harmless — big analytics jobs from the Copperline team are the typical culprit. If it fires during your review window, don't panic and don't merge schema migrations until it clears. Check the lag graph first; if it's climbing past five minutes or flapping repeatedly, that's worth a human look. Questions or weird patterns? Drop a note to the data platform crew.

escalation mailbox, hadug-bajog: sormir@norvalabs.internal

## Account Recovery — Trailnote Offline Mode

When a surveyor's Trailnote app has been offline for 30+ days, their local credentials expire and sync refuses to resume. Don't make them wipe the device — all their unsynced field data lives there! Instead, open the support console, pick "Offline Reinstate," and enter their handle. The console will ask for the support team's shared recovery passphrase before issuing a reinstatement token. Use the one below.

unlock words, bagaf-fajeg: zorael-kelax-fraath-quenix-eliok-sileth-aldmir-wenir-druiel

Support team, heads up: after upgrading the Corvid message broker to the new major version, CI jobs in the Tallgrass pipeline may fail during the queue-bind step. The new broker rejects anonymous exchange declarations, which our older test fixtures still use. Workaround: re-run the job with the fixtures-v2 flag set, which uses the updated declarations. A permanent fixture migration lands next sprint. If a customer reports related delivery stalls, confirm they are on the build noted below.

build token for yajof-bajof: htk31_506ff1188f74596b5bb2eec94edc43c